      OK.  I’ve been troubleshooting, trying to figure out what’s going on with the texture library.

      Crappy timing.  I’m trying to get some nice renderings to a client this afternoon, and 2020 is not cooperating!

      I’ve sussed out a couple more details:
      -The textures that weren’t rendering at all had no descriptions.  I edited the descriptions using the new dialog.
      -Now they render, but they render very dark, like Danny is experiencing, above.

    • June 30, 2016 at 3:32 pm #94087
      Chris Setlock
      Participant

      OK.  It’s definitely an issue with the user texture library.

      As an experiment, I used the octagon and dot tile from the common library.  It worked just fine.  The then right clicked, saved it to the user texture library, edited the size, and used it again.  Now, it renders very dark.
